Best Howard County Public Elementary Schools (2026)

For the 2026 school year, there are 5 public elementary schools serving 1,552 students in Howard County, AR.
The top-ranked public elementary schools in Howard County, AR are Nashville Primary School, Nashville Elementary School and Joann Walters Elementary School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Howard County, AR public elementary schools have an average math proficiency score of 47% (versus the Arkansas public elementary school average of 45%), and reading proficiency score of 35% (versus the 40% statewide average). Elementary schools in Howard County have an average ranking of 6/10, which is in the top 50% of Arkansas public elementary schools.
Minority enrollment is 45% of the student body (majority Black), which is more than the Arkansas public elementary school average of 43% (majority Black).
